china-defense-mashup.com

ShutKeys Rank:

China Military Power Mashup | China Powerful Military News, images and videos information

Traffic details

Powered by AdvSites.net

Disposition of 327 Organic Keywords

1-3 position 4-100 position
11 316
The look of china-defense-mashup.com thumbnail of the china-defense-mashup.com